neliiware County champions have n
reniiirkable record, which ehews that
in nine g.nneii played this season net
a tingle point has been scored against
' them. '
' The train played and the hcerca are '
as follews: 5Iedia. ,';7-0; Hehart. fi-O:
Ambler. '.'0-0; Wildwood. 0-0: Hunt-
. lug A. A.. Hl-0; ClearGeld, 0-0; Vb-
tnv. 20-0: Westinghouse. ti-0: Dc-
tianre, of Wilmington, KM), making a
i total of 121 points. j
